bionet.ted.rt.IAFRealTimeEncoder¶
- class bionet.ted.rt.IAFRealTimeEncoder(dt, b, d, R=inf, C=1.0, dte=0.0, quad_method='trapz')¶
Real-time IAF neuron time encoding machine.
This class implements a real-time time encoding machine that uses an Integrate-and-Fire neuron to encode data.
Parameters: dt : float
Sampling resolution of input signal; the sampling frequency is 1/dt Hz.
b : float
Encoder bias.
d : float
Encoder threshold.
R : float
Neuron resistance.
C : float
Neuron capacitance.
dte : float
Sampling resolution assumed by the encoder. This may not exceed dt.
quad_method : {‘rect’, ‘trapz’}
Quadrature method to use (rectangular or trapezoidal).
